Today myself and my family visited The Kernow Lounge for the first time and what a delight it was. When we arrived Robin the owner welcomed us with a warm welcome and a friendly smile. First impressions of the coffee shop were what a cute little place this is especially the greeting from the resident dog who is just adorable and so friendly. There were lots of things to look at around the shop including hand made items made by residents of millbrook which customers can buy which I thought was a great addition, especially as these items were bright and colourful. Looking at the menu board and cake counter there was lots of choice. I chose a latte which was just so creamy and smooth (I’m quite fussy with my coffee), my son had a strawberry milkshake which was topped with cream and marshmallows and chocolate sprinkles which again was just delicious (I had to also give it the taste test)! My other son had a tub of vanilla ice cream which was by roskilleys and it was a generous sized scoop of it! Myself and my husband wanted to try the cake selection so ordered a piece of the chocolate brownie and a yoghurt topped raspberry flapjack slice which he said was just stunning. The chocolate brownie was so gooey and moist which is how I think brownies should be so that went down a treat! The portion sizes were really generous too. We sat outside which was lovely especially as the sun was shining and it was a warm afternoon. We really enjoyed our visit to the Kernow Lounge today and combined it with a lovely walk around a beautiful lake which also had a fantastic play park and skate park for the children. It really makes a brilliant family outing as there is something for the whole family to do. My boys have already told us what they are having next time so they clearly enjoyed themselves. Thanks to the Kernow Lounge for some lovely treats today, we will be back very soon.
